Feature Freeze Exception
------------------------
The Ubuntu Desktop Team would like to update mutter and gnome-shell to
3.27.92.
mutter's soname was bumped so we need to update budgie-desktop too.
This has been done and tested successfully in the GNOME3 Staging PPA.
https://gitlab.gnome.org/GNOME/mutter/blob/master/NEWS
https://gitlab.gnome.org/GNOME/gnome-shell/blob/master/NEWS
Feature Freeze Exception Justification
-------------------------------------
GNOME was late in doing its mutter and gnome-shell release this cycle.
We could have rushed those two in to 18.04 but there are a few
regressions that we wanted to fix first, and a key developer had some
time off in late February.
Known Issues
------------
- The 70_allow_sound_above_100.patch needs to be rebased (probably by
didrocks)
- The "keycaps" (labels for Shift, Enter, etc.) in the new screen keyboard
show in the GNOME session but not the Ubuntu session
- ubuntu-session-mods/ubuntu.css probably needs to be rebased (and that will
probably fix the keycaps issue)
Relation to Other Transitions
-----------------------------
This will unlock the gnome-settings-daemon transition
budgie-desktop is part of the ongoing gnome-desktop3 transition.
gnome-shell will be part of the evolution-data-server transition.
